Bill and Melinda Gates announced that they will commit $10 billion over the next 10 years to help research, develop, and deliver vaccines to developing countries. They cite PATH's Rotavirus Vaccine Program and the New England Journal of Medicine research as examples of encouraging progress that inspired them to commit more resources to this endeavor. Though this level of funding for vaccines is unprecedented, funding from donors is still crucial.
